PELeakage Current
Application
Measurement of protective conductor current may be performed
in the case of safety class I devices for which it cannot be assured
that all components exposed to line voltage are tested by means
of insulation resistance measurement, or if insulation resistance
measurement cannot be performed for other reasons.
Definition of Differential Current
Sum of instantaneous current values which flow via the L and N
conductors at the device mains connection. Differential current is
practically identical to fault current in the event of an error. Fault
current: Current which is caused by an insulation defect, and
which flows via the defective point.
Definition of Equivalent Measurement
Equivalent leakage current is current which flows through active
conductors of the device which are connected to each other (L/N)
to the protective conductor (SC1), or to exposed, conductive
parts (SC2).
Definition of Protective Conductor Current (direct measurement)
Current which flows through the protective conductor with
housings which are isolated from ground.
Differential Current Measuring Method
The device under test is operated with mains power. The sum of
the momentary values of all currents which flow through all active
conductors (L/N) at the mains side of the device connection is
measured. The measurements must be performed with mains
plug polarity in both directions.
Equivalent Measurement Method
A high-impedance power supply is connected between the
short-circuited mains terminals and all exposed metal parts of the
housing (which are connected to one another).
Current which flows over the insulation at the device under test is
measured.
Protective Conductor Current Measuring Method (direct measurement)
The device under test is operated with mains power. Current
which flows through the PE conductor to earth at the mains side
of the device connection is measured.
